Moalboal, officially the Municipality of Moalboal, , is a 4th class municipality in the province of Cebu, Philippines. According to the 2015 census, it has a population of 31,130 people.Extending as a peninsula on the south-western tip of Cebu, Moalboal is bordered to the west by the Tañon Strait. Negros Island can be seen from the western shoreline. Moalboal is located 89 kilometres from Cebu City, about 2½ hours by bus. Moalboal is bordered to the north by the town of Alcantara, to the west is the Tañon Strait, to the east is the town of Argao, and to the south is the town of Badian.     Pescador Island is an island located in the Tañon Strait, a few kilometres from the western coast of the island of Cebu in the Philippines. It is part of the municipality of Moalboal. The island derives its name from the Philippines' Spanish colonial heritage and the abundance of fish living on the surrounding coral reef, and the many fishermen that fish them . The rich marine life also attracts recreational divers from the many dive operations in nearby Panagsama. The underwater composition of the Pescador island reef is a sandy slope covered with soft coral from 5–10 metres , followed by a wall covered with hard corals dropping down to about 40 metres .
